Animal recognition is a fundamental aspect of early childhood literacy and education, making it crucial for both parents and teachers. Understanding various animals not only enriches a child’s vocabulary but also enhances cognitive development. Recognizing animals helps children learn to categorize and differentiate between living things, promoting critical thinking skills.

In addition to literacy gains, animal recognition fosters curiosity about the environment and encourages exploration of nature. Children who can name and recognize animals develop a stronger connection to their surroundings, which is vital for fostering environmental awareness and compassion for living creatures.

Interactive reading materials featuring animals can enhance engagement and spark interest in stories among young readers. This emotional connection to the content often translates into improved comprehension and retention.

Furthermore, discussing animals creates opportunities for cross-curricular learning, incorporating science and geography into reading. Through stories about animals, children can learn not only about biodiversity but also about habitats, life cycles, and conservation efforts.

Ultimately, nurturing animal recognition skills in young learners equips them with essential literacy tools and instills a sense of wonder and respect for the natural world, preparing them to be informed and compassionate individuals in the future.
